Japan Pemetrexed Injection Market Insights
The application of Pemetrexed Injection in Japan primarily revolves around the treatment of various types of cancers, notably non-small cell lung cancer (NSCLC) and malignant pleural mesothelioma. As a chemotherapy agent, Pemetrexed is used in combination with other drugs to improve patient outcomes and extend survival rates. Its targeted mechanism helps inhibit folate-dependent enzymes involved in DNA synthesis, making it effective against rapidly dividing cancer cells. The growing prevalence of lung and mesothelioma cancers in Japan, coupled with advancements in oncology treatments, has driven the demand for Pemetrexed injections. Additionally, increasing awareness among healthcare professionals and patients about the benefits of targeted chemotherapy options further propels market growth. The expanding geriatric population, which is more susceptible to cancer, also contributes to the rising application of this medication in clinical settings across Japan.

Japan Pemetrexed Injection Market By Type Segment Analysis
The Pemetrexed injection market in Japan is primarily classified into two key segments based on formulation type: lyophilized powder and ready-to-use liquid formulations. The lyophilized powder segment remains dominant due to its longer shelf life, stability, and widespread acceptance in clinical settings, accounting for approximately 65% of the total market. Conversely, the ready-to-use liquid formulations are gaining traction owing to their convenience, reduced preparation time, and lower risk of contamination, representing around 35% of the market. Over the next five years, the ready-to-use segment is expected to exhibit a higher comp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of approximately 8%, driven by technological advancements and increasing demand for streamlined treatment protocols.

Japan Pemetrexed Injection Market By Application Segment Analysis
The application landscape of the Pemetrexed injection market in Japan is predominantly centered around non-small cell lung cancer (NSCLC) and malignant pleural mesothelioma, with NSCLC accounting for approximately 70% of total usage. This segment is driven by the high prevalence of lung cancer in Japan, which is among the leading causes of cancer-related mortality. The second major application is mesothelioma, which, although less prevalent, benefits from targeted therapeutic protocols involving Pemetrexed. Other applications, such as thymoma and other solid tumors, constitute a smaller but growing share, supported by ongoing clinical research and expanding therapeutic indications.
The market for NSCLC treatment is experiencing rapid growth, with an estimated CAGR of 7-9% over the next five years, fueled by increasing diagnosis rates and evolving treatment guidelines favoring combination therapies involving Pemetrexed.
